您是否试图阻止 wordpress 一直将您注销?
这是一个常见的 wordpress 错误,几乎不可能在您的网站上工作。
在本文中,我们将向您展示如何解决 wordpress 不断注销问题,也称为 wordpress 会话超时问题。
为什么wordpress一直注销?
wordpress 不断将您注销有几个主要原因。但最常见的是,您正在尝试从与您的 wordpress 设置中的 URL 不匹配的 URL 访问您的网站。
当您登录WordPress网站时,它将在您的浏览器中设置一个cookie来验证登录会话。cookie 是为存储在设置菜单中的 wordpress URL 设置的。
如果站点 URL 和 wordpress URL 不匹配,则 wordpress 将无法对会话进行身份验证,您将被注销。
在下图中,“wordpress地址”和“站点地址”不同,因此会有冲突。
话虽如此,让我们向您展示如何轻松解决wordpress不断注销的问题。
如何修复wordpress不断注销问题
解决此登录问题的最简单方法是确保您在“站点地址”和“wordpress 地址”字段中具有相同的 URL。
为此,请导航到 wordpress 管理面板中的“设置”»“常规”。
然后,仔细检查 URL 是否匹配。您需要在这两个字段中选择“www”或“non-www”URL。
从技术上讲,“www”本身就是一个子域。这意味着带有“www”和没有“www”的 URL 实际上是两个不同的域名。
幸运的是,将 URL 更改和更新为同一地址将解决该问题。然后,只需确保单击“保存更改”按钮即可。
修复 wordpress 通过向 wordpress 添加代码来保持注销问题
如果您无法访问 wordpress 仪表板,则需要手动编辑 wp-config.php 文件。这是一个特殊的文件,其中包含您网站的重要 wordpress 设置。
为此,您可以使用 FileZilla 等 FTP 客户端或 wordpress 托管帐户控制面板中的文件管理器应用程序。
然后,在站点的根目录中找到wp-config.php文件。
您可以将文件下载到桌面,然后在您喜欢的文本编辑器(如记事本)中打开它。
之后,在行上方添加以下代码,上面写着“就这样,停止编辑!祝您出版愉快':
define('WP_HOME','https://example.com');
define('WP_SITEURL','https://example.com');
如果要在 URL 中使用“www”,则可以改用以下代码:
define('WP_HOME','https://www.example.com');
define('WP_SITEURL','https://www.example.com');
确保将“example.com”URL 替换为您自己的 wordpress 博客 URL。
然后,您需要保存文件并将其上传回根目录。当您登录您的网站时,wordpress 现在应该停止注销您。
如果您仍然遇到相同的注销问题,请参阅我们的指南,了解如何解决 wordpress 登录页面刷新和重定向问题。
关于wordpress注销的常见问题
以下是我们的读者向我们询问的有关wordpress注销的最常见问题的答案。
为什么wordpress一直把我注销?
在大多数情况下,wordpress 会不断将您注销,因为您尝试从与您的 wordpress 设置中的 URL 不匹配的 URL 访问您的网站。
每次您登录 wordpress 网站时,它都会在浏览器中保存一个 cookie 以验证登录会话。Cookie 将保存在您的设置菜单中的 wordpress URL 中。
如果站点 URL 和 wordpress URL 不同,则 wordpress 将无法对会话进行身份验证,并且您将被注销。
wordpress 需要多长时间才能将您注销?
默认的 wordpress 登录会话将在 48 小时后过期。然后,wordpress将注销您,您必须重新登录。
您可以通过选中 wordpress 登录屏幕上“记住我”旁边的框来解决这个问题。然后,系统将在 14 天内提示您重新登录。